Summary
The Hindu Disposition of Property Act, 1916 is an important piece of legislation that governs the disposal of property by Hindus. This act aims to provide a uniform and comprehensive system for the transfer of property and to simplify the procedure for its disposal. The act defines the legal rights of heirs and legal representatives of the deceased and outlines the manner in which property may be disposed of. The act also provides guidelines for the execution of wills, the rights of widows and daughters, and the settlement of disputes arising from the disposal of property.
